Situation:
The property is situated in a quiet residential road within a short walk of the local amenities and St James' Primary School, and within easy reach of Tunbridge Wells town centre and the station. The town is renowned for its comprehensive range of facilities and amenities, including the Royal Victoria Place shopping centre, cinema complex and theatres.
For the commuter, Tunbridge Wells station serves London Bridge, Charing Cross and Cannon Street in under an hour.
Description:
The property is an attractive and beautifully presented home, offering versatile accommodation throughout and the potential to enlarge still further if required (STC). The property also benefits from an outbuilding with power which is felt could be used as a home office.
Arranged over three floors, the accommodation comprises, on the ground floor; a well-proportioned living room with attractive wood flooring, a fireplace with gloss hearth, and adjacent understairs storage cupboard; a kitchen/breakfast room with a wide range of shaker style wall and base units, complementary work surfaces, breakfast bar, attractive tile splashbacks, an oven, 4 ring hob with stainless steel splashback and extractor, and plumbing for a dishwasher, washing machine, and dryer; a rear lobby with adjacent downstairs w/c with attractive wall tiling; and a light, airy, and spacious family room with vaulted ceiling with Velux windows and French doors providing access to the private garden.
On the first floor is a landing and two good-sized double bedrooms, with the principal bedroom benefiting from a walk-in wardrobe, and a spacious family bathroom featuring a bath with shower over, attractive gloss wall tiling, and chrome towel rail.
On the top floor is a loft room with dual aspect Velux windows which is ideal for either a home office or playroom.
To the front of the property is a garden boarded by a picket fence and gate which is laid to shingle.
To the rear is a private low maintenance garden featuring raised decking and bordered by mature plants and shrubs, and a good-sized outbuilding (extending to almost13ft) with power, storage cupboards, double glazed windows, and French doors.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
